Capitol Hill, DC Housing Market

The Capitol Hill housing market is somewhat competitive. The median sale price of a home in Capitol Hill was $926K last month, up 5.8% since last year. The median sale price per square foot in Capitol Hill is $577, down 4.9% since last year. What is the housing market like in Capitol Hill today? In July 2025, Capitol Hill home prices were up 5.8% compared to last year, selling for a median price of $926K. On average, homes in Capitol Hill sell after 44 days on the market compared to 33 days last year. There were 213 homes sold in July this year, up from 194 last year.

Capitol Hill offers a range of townhomes, including historic brick rowhouses, fully renovated modern townhomes, and newly constructed luxury residences. Many feature historic details like fireplaces, original wood floors, and large front porches, alongside contemporary upgrades.

 

 

Prices generally start around $700,000 for smaller or older homes and can easily exceed $2 million for larger, fully renovated townhomes or luxury properties near the Capitol, Eastern Market, or Lincoln Park. Size, condition, and location greatly influence pricing.

 

 

Top locations include Eastern Market (for its vibrant shopping and dining scene), Stanton Park, Lincoln Park, and Barracks Row. Townhomes near the U.S. Capitol or along leafy side streets like East Capitol Street are especially prized.
